Obesity is a chronic condition that leads to various health problems in the body. The main health issues caused or significantly increased in risk by obesity include:
* Type 2 diabetes
* High blood pressure (hypertension)
* Dyslipidemia (high blood fats and cholesterol)
* Fatty liver disease
* Atherosclerosis and other cardiovascular diseases
* Joint disorders and osteoarthritis
* Sleep apnea syndrome
* In women: Polycystic ovary syndrome (ovarian cysts, menstrual irregularities, and excessive hair growth)
* In boys: Buried penis and hormonal imbalances
* Psychological issues such as depression and anxiety
* Certain types of cancers (e.g., colorectal, breast, uterine, kidney)
